    A rather realistic cost for the production of a large scale RPG, possibly lowballing it. Remember skullgirls asking $250k to develop a single character? Computer game development is expensive.

    Project Eternity asked for $1.1million. Torment asked for $900k. Wasteland 2 asked for $900k.
